In Oregon, open enrollment for ACA Marketplace individual and family health coverage is from November 1 through January 15. Enrolling in an exchange plan or changing your coverage outside of the open enrollment period is possible if you meet the criteria for a Special Enrollment Period (SEP). 8 This means you must have a qualifying life event, such as losing your health insurance, getting ...

Even Oregon's best short-term health insurance cannot replace a Marketplace plan. Short-term insurance may offer limited benefits and can reject applicants with pre-existing conditions. What is short term health insurance? Find quick answers to common questions to ensure temporary health insurance is a good fit for you and your family.Short-term health insurance offers basic coverage for a limited time. Short-term plans in Oregon can’t last longer than three months. These plans can cost less than traditional plans, but they aren’t required to cover the ACA’s essential benefits and can reject you or charge you more for preexisting conditions.

Contributions started on Jan. 1, 2023. Employees can begin to apply for benefits starting Aug. 14, 2023. Benefits begin Sept. 3, 2023. Check short-term health insurance plan availability in Oregon and shop for coverage. Learn about state regulations regarding short-term plan duration and renewal.Oregon’s Mini-COBRA Law. Oregon’s Mini-COBRA law, which is also known as the Oregon Continuation of Health Coverage law, was enacted under Oregon Revised Statutes (ORS) Chapter 743B. According to the state of Oregon, "It is a violation of Oregon law to market, sell, or offer short-term health insurance policies that exceed three months, including renewals, and a new policy cannot be issued to a customer within 60 days of expiration".
